Dr. Catherine Mazzola - Board Certified Pediatric Neurological Surgeon; New Jersey Pediatric Neurosurgical Associates, PA
ccording to the American Board of Pediatric Neurological Surgeons website, (www. abpns.org) there are only two board-certified pediatric neurosurgeons in New Jersey. As a fellowship-trained, pediatric neurosurgeon, Dr. Cathy Mazzola treats children with traumatic brain injury, concussions, hydrocephalus, brain tumors, spine tumors, tethered spinal cord, craniofacial diagnoses, and plagiocephaly. She also cares for adult neurosurgical patients with congenital disorders, like cerebral palsy and spina bifida. Dr. Mazzola has written many articles about brain tumors, spina bifida, and brain injury that have been published in peer-reviewed journals. Dr. Mazzola has over 15 years of experience in neurological surgery. She was trained by Drs. Peter Carmel, Arno Fried, Fred Epstein, Leland Albright, Ian Pollack, and David Adelson -- all well-known pediatric neurosurgeons. Less than five percent of all neurosurgeons are women, and there are only a few pediatric neurosurgeons in New Jersey. As the mother of five children, Dr. Mazzola understands the responsibilities of parenthood. When she sees children with developmental disabilities, she is able to empathize with parents who have children with special needs. Dr. Mazzola began volunteering for the Congress of Neurosurgeons (CNS), the
A
national organization of neurosurgeons, in 2001. She is one of the few women who have been elected to the Executive Committee of CNS. Dr. Mazzola’s manuscript discussing the risks of work hour reduction in neurosurgical residency was selected as the lead article in the August 2010 NEUROSURGERY journal. As a prominent leader among women in neurosurgery, Dr. Mazzola recognizes her responsibility to mentor to students interested in neurosurgery. Dr. Mazzola has mentored over 40 pre-med and medical students throughout her career. Dr. Mazzola was responsible for the creation of the Neuromuscular and Movements Disorder Center for Children at Hackensack University Medical Center in 2001 and the Craniofacial and Cleft Lip and Palate Center at Morristown Memorial Hospital in 2006. She has cared for thousands of children with neurosurgical disorders in New Jersey. In July 2009, she started her own practice: New Jersey Pediatric Neurosurgical Associates. Dr. Mazzola accepted the challenge of developing a unique, specialty practice that accommodates children and adults with all aspects of congenital and pediatric neurosurgical disorders.
